Other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— Gross Production Value in Zimbabwe
Zimbabwe: Other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— Gross Production Value was 421,295 1000 USD in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— Gross Production Value in Zimbabwe, 1961–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 USD.
Analysis
In 2024, other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— gross production value in Zimbabwe stood at 421,295 1000 USD.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.4% on the previous year and up 27.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, other vegetables, fresh n.e.c. — gross production value in Zimbabwe peaked at 472,667 1000 USD in 2019 and was at its lowest, 87,527 1000 USD, in 1961.
That places Zimbabwe 18th out of 122 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
